Transaction 216f023eaf603dd701c9e2fc06c2857f33f7f308aaeafabd26199a94b32f7864

1 Input
2 Outputs
  • 216f023eaf603dd701c9e2fc06c2857f33f7f308aaeafabd26199a94b32f7864:0
  • value  518188
    address  1BpQDWztU6hnc5BDACJ8oY9JVaMjCz5Jnr
  • 216f023eaf603dd701c9e2fc06c2857f33f7f308aaeafabd26199a94b32f7864:1
  • value  40880000
    address  176Lp2atE7MQP4yNfhVxsitydwMvc1HmL